Why Buy a Folding Treadmill?
A folding treadmill is a great choice for those looking to boost their daily exercise and remain in good shape. They are easy to use small, compact and inexpensive.
Be aware of the deck's width and length when shopping for a treadmill that folds. If you like to run up hills, a bigger deck will be better for you.
Space Savers You a Lot of Space
A treadmill folding incline that folds is a great way to stay fit and healthy if you live within a small space or apartment. This type of treadmill features a deck that can be folded upwards between the handrails to reduce its size by half. The non-folding models, on the other hand, are larger and require more floor space. It is worthwhile to test a few different models to see what you prefer in case you are concerned about space.
First, you need to decide what you will use the treadmill for. If you're an avid runner, you will probably require a treadmill that has an extended deck and wider belt to accommodate the natural strides of running. It is also important to ensure whether the treadmill can take your weight and any additional weights you may be using during your workout like ankle weights or vests.
In addition, if you plan to run for a short distance or jogging in a smaller, cheaper folding treadmill will be fine. These models typically have a smaller deck and don't have the same features as more expensive models that do not fold. If you intend to run for longer then you should try the treadmill prior to purchasing it. Some models that fold may not offer the stability you require.
If you have a basement or attic or attic, it can be a great spot to store a treadmill. It will be less of an eye sore than if it were located in your living room or in another highly-trafficked area. You should have enough space in the front of your treadmill to allow for airflow, which will help keep the motor and electronics at a low temperature.
If you also have a loft space that has been converted into a dining or living room, this can be a great place to put a treadmill. It is important to be sure there is enough room in front of the machine for adequate airflow and to prevent any damage caused by storing it high.
Reduced Risk of Injury
While it is still important to take precautions and follow proper training procedures when using a treadmill however, a treadmill that folds will not put you at the same risk like a treadmill that doesn't fold. Having a treadmill in your home will allow you to work out anytime and may result in less soreness and a better sleeping at night. Training at the right intensity to achieve your goals is important. This will keep you from overtraining and causing injuries such as muscle strain.
Before getting on a treadmill, you should always perform at least a few minutes of fast walking or running to circulate your blood and to warm your muscles. After that, you should perform some stretching exercises that tighten your muscles and prevent them from becoming sore or injured.
When you're running on treadmill, it is crucial to look forward and not at the console. If you look down, it can cause you to slump over and cause a lot of strain for your posture or back and neck. You should also avoid staring at the belt of the treadmill, since this could cause you to fall off.
If you're a runner, the larger deck will fit your stride better and lessen the impact on your joints. When you are exercising on a treadmill, it is essential to wear shoes that have cushioning and maintain a healthy posture. Ask a fitness professional if you're not sure which speed and incline range are the most suitable for you.
